The Bluffs at Playa Vista

Nestled in a lush, park-like setting, The Bluffs at Playa Vista is a LEED Gold certified, trophy creative office campus located in the heart of the Playa Vista submarket in West Los Angeles. Consisting of two five-story office buildings totaling approximately 500,000 square feet, the Property boasts state-of-the-art building systems, expansive floor plates with dual cores for optimum space planning flexibility, ample parking in a six-level parking structure, and 13-foot exposed slab to slab ceiling heights and floor-to-ceiling windows offering abundant natural light and sweeping views of the bluffs

Jeffrey Sussman

Executive Vice President of Leasing, Building Management & Operations

Edward J. Minskoff Equities, Inc.

Jeffrey M. Sussman is Executive Vice President in charge of all leasing, building management and

operations at Edward J. Minskoff Equities, Inc. Mr. Sussman is also instrumental in all new development

and acquisition projects for the company. Currently, Mr. Sussman is responsible for the repositioning

and leasing of 1166 Avenue of the Americas and 825 Seventh Avenue along with management and

leasing of the New York office portfolio which includes 51 Astor Place, Federal Aviation Administration

Regional Headquarters, 101 Avenue of the Americas, 270 Greenwich Street and 590 Madison Avenue.

Mr. Sussman was an integral part of the acquisition team and now manages The Bluffs at Playa Vista,

EJME’s newest acquisition, a 500,000 rsf office complex in Los Angeles.

Mr. Sussman was responsible for the management/administration and leasing at such high profile New

York office buildings such as 712 Fifth Avenue, 660 Madison, 450 Park Avenue, 1325 Avenue of the

Americas, 1350 Avenue of the Americas, 150 East 52nd Street and 600 Third Avenue. He was also

responsible for other properties owned by various members of the Minskoff family located around the

country and included holdings of over 1.4 million square feet of space.

Mr. Sussman started his career working for Mr. Minskoff at Olympia & York Properties as Assistant

Project Coordinator of the World Financial Center project. His responsibilities included coordinating and

directing development, design, construction and management of project’s public spaces.

Mr. Sussman holds a Masters of City and Regional Planning degree from the John F. Kennedy School of

Government at Harvard University and Bachelor of Arts in Urban Studies and Political Science degrees

from Stanford University.

Kent Handleman

SVP

LPC West

Kent Handleman oversees all leasing activity for LPC West Los Angeles. With over 28 years of transactional experience encompassing over 10 million square feet of space, he manages a portfolio with 4+ million square feet of office projects, and represents ownerships that include LPC West partnerships, associated capital partners, and third-party owners throughout the South Bay, Playa Vista, Culver City, Santa Monica, downtown Los Angeles, Tri-Cities, and the San Fernando Valley. Prior to joining LPC West, Kent led leasing efforts for Thomas Properties Group in Southern California. This included City National Plaza, a 2.6-million square foot premier office complex in downtown Los Angeles, where he successfully leased approximately 2 million square feet as the project was repositioned in the market. Prior to this, Kent worked at CBRE where he represented tenants and landlords in the leasing, disposition and/or marketing of commercial office property. Kent’s tenure in the industry began in real estate acquisitions and financial analysis for a pension fund advisor. After completing his MBA at the USC Marshall School of Business, he joined MetLife Real Estate Investments and, in addition to hotel and multi-family projects, he oversaw leasing and asset management for a 3.5-million square foot office building portfolio, with 2.5 million square feet in downtown Los Angeles. In his capacity as an asset manager, Kent also directed property management, and was responsible for business/investment decisions regarding these office, hotel, and multi-family projects as owner’s representative.

Milan Ratkovich

Senior Development Manager

Ratkovich Company

Milan Ratkovich is a Senior Development Manager with The Ratkovich Company. Milan originally joined the company after graduating from UCLA in 1992, and rejoined the company in 2005 after spending nine years in the United States Marine Corps serving as a heavy helicopter pilot and flight instructor.

Milan’s recent projects include the renovation of The Hercules Campus at Playa Vista, a 530,000 square foot project consisting of eleven nationally registered historic landmark buildings incorporating the former Howard Hughes offices and the 330,000 square foot hangar in which the “Spruce Goose” was built.

Previous projects include The Alhambra where Milan managed the entitlement of 311 for-sale residential units as well as the development of a 50,000 square foot LA Fitness center and accompanying 760 car parking structure. Milan also was the Development Manager at 5900 Wilshire, a 31-story Class A office building located in the Miracle Mile. During his tenure there, 5900 Wilshire was awarded BOMA’s TOBY award.

Currently Milan is the Senior Development Manager of both The Hercules Campus at Playa Vista and The Bloc in Downtown Los Angeles. The Bloc is a mixed use development consisting of 730,000 square feet of office space, 430,000 square feet of retail space and a 496 room Sheraton Grand hotel.
